[REL] Algerine Class minesweepers
 
Hello!

Tired of big ships, I did the late-war escort minesweepers (or fleet minesweepers) of the Algerine class, of which 110 were built. I tried trading size for level of detail and that's the result:

http://www.mediafire.com/conv/ddc951...941235466g.jpg

Based on their characteristics, I classified them as corvettes (unit type 1). So, they happily will attack submarines.

DL: http://www.mediafire.com/file/lmrgrw...lgerine_mod.7z

EDIT: I updated the archive file; the Ship_names_MS_Algerine.cfg file has been corrected for typing errors
Here's a direct link to that file: http://www.mediafire.com/file/akgadg...MSAlgerine.cfg

Also, the model is my tribute to JuJuGrotjans artwork done during the intial phases of SH3 modding. I used parts of his textures when doing those of the Algerine.

@LemonA: That's the deckplan of a British-built Algerine, likely the one re-drawn by John Lambert. In addition to that, I used the copy of the booklet of general plans of thje Canadian HMCS Winnipeg (J337) as reference. The plan can be downloaded here:
http://www.hnsa.org/doc/plans/j337.pdf

@wolfstriked: You want to be escorted out of port by an Algerine minesweeper? Well, they were British and Canadian vessels. Better stay in company with a type M35 minesweepers or some Räumboot (both in GWX).
But it can be done ... The M35 mineswepers are classified as corvettes, as the Algerines. So, you first need to place a copy of the *.cfg file in the Canadian or British sea roster into the respective German roster. Next, you need to opend the scripted layer of the campaign files and replace the desired entries pointing to MS1935 by MSAlgerine.
